Our first year of being on a healthy plant-based nutrition was a great examination for us. It was a time when our tastes were unstable and there were so many temptations around.

But we overcame these moments.

Of course, from time to time our son asks for something tasty. He haven’t ever tried candies or milk chocolate, because these products were restricted by gastroenterologist. But we always used white sugar before.

In fact, nowadays there are different variants of tasty snacks without sugar: handmade marmalade (we can buy it in the local market), vegan chocolate (it’s made of cocoa butter and kerob) and various vegan biscuits.

We found such a tasty chocolate cake in one of the raw cafes. It was Egor’s birthday cake this year.

In almost every restaurants with a traditional menu we can find grilled vegetables.

This year at the age of 7 Egor went to a private school. Most of the children at school treat each other with candies, which contain sugar. Of course, sugar-free organic lolipops are more healthy variant for children.

During the first two years of being on a healthy plant-based nutrition we haven’t tried any ice-cream. But in Sochi we found a great place with a delicious vegan ice-cream. It contains nut milk and no sugar.
